Transaction 34d9025ee14e52c13fbf5ed23de39656c79b5486b146ecdf82a4add55d938992

1 Input
2 Outputs
  • 34d9025ee14e52c13fbf5ed23de39656c79b5486b146ecdf82a4add55d938992:0
  • value  16005632
    address  34GU1WxxEqwHrNwJekXq1gGzqDLhafuxvk
  • 34d9025ee14e52c13fbf5ed23de39656c79b5486b146ecdf82a4add55d938992:1
  • value  604163
    address  36UHxMheQDSw8erNRnVNHj3Uj5HTFxfHd5